Understanding the Basics of Web Design

 

Web design includes planning, making, and keeping websites up-to-date. It covers different areas like user interface design, user experience design, graphic design, and search engine optimization. This may seem overwhelming, but many tools and resources can help make it easier.

There are many platforms where you can create a free website. Still, for a professional online presence, it’s smart to buy a custom domain name. Your domain name is your website’s address on the internet, like www.yourbusinessname.com. A custom domain name adds trust and helps customers find you more easily.

Key Elements of a Successful Business Website

A successful business website should do more than just look nice. It must work well, be easy to use, and be set up to boost sales.

Here are some important things to think about:

Clear and simple content: Your website should have content that is easy to read, helpful, and interesting. It should clearly show the value of your products or services.

Easy navigation: Your website needs to be well-organized. User-friendly navigation helps visitors find what they need quickly and easily, making their experience better.

Search engine optimization (SEO): You need to optimize your website for search engines like Google. This will help bring in traffic. Use relevant keywords, optimize your page titles and descriptions, and build quality backlinks.

Mobile responsiveness: Many people use mobile devices to browse. It is important that your website adjusts well to different screen sizes for a great user experience.

Ecommerce features: If you plan to sell online, you need ecommerce features on your site. This means having product pages, shopping carts, secure payment options, and systems to manage orders.

Customizable templates: Use a website builder that offers customizable templates. This way, you can create a unique website that matches your brand’s style.

By focusing on these aspects, you can have a successful business website that shows your brand well, attracts customers, and helps your business grow.

Gathering Essential Tools and Resources

Once you know what your website will be about and who will visit it, you need to gather important tools to create your website.

The most important tool is a website builder. A website builder makes it easy to design and develop your site without any need for coding skills. They usually provide different templates, a drag-and-drop system, and options to customize your site to fit your brand. Find a website builder that works for you and your skill level.

Next, you need a domain name. This is the unique web address that people type into their browser to visit your site. Choose a domain name that shows what your business is about, is easy to remember, and is available with a common extension like .com, .org, or .net.

Lastly, you will need web hosting. This service keeps your website’s files and lets people access your site on the internet. When picking a hosting service, think about important factors like reliability, uptime, customer support, and how much storage space you need.

Step 7: Testing and Launching Your Website

Before launching your website, thoroughly test all functionalities across different browsers and devices to ensure a seamless user experience. This includes verifying links, forms, multimedia elements, and navigation to ensure everything functions as intended. Proofread your content carefully for any errors or typos.

Testing Aspect

Description

Functionality Testing

Ensure all website features, links, buttons, and forms are working correctly.

Compatibility Testing

Check website compatibility across different web browsers (Chrome, Firefox, Safari, Edge) and devices (desktop, mobile, tablet).

Usability Testing

Gather feedback from users to assess the website’s ease of use, navigation, and overall user experience.

Performance Testing

Evaluate website loading speed, responsiveness, and performance under different traffic conditions.

Security Testing

Conduct security scans to identify and address vulnerabilities and ensure website and user data protection.

Once you are confident everything is in order, it’s time to launch your website! Select a launch date and time and promote it across your marketing channels to create excitement and generate initial traffic.

Ensuring Mobile Responsiveness

In today’s world, it is vital that your website works well on mobile devices. When we say mobile-responsive, we mean your website changes its layout and content to fit various screen sizes. This helps provide a good experience for users, whether they are on smartphones, tablets, or desktops.

If your website does not respond well on mobile, it can upset users. This may cause them to leave your site quickly and miss out on what you offer. To avoid this, pick a website builder or a website template that is mobile-friendly. Make sure to test your website on different devices. This way, you can see if everything looks good and the experience is smooth.

For example, if you run a real estate website with property listings, it’s important that images, property details, and contact information are easy to see and use on smaller mobile screens. This will help you capture leads better.

Employing Email Marketing Strategies

Email marketing is a great way to promote your website, find new customers, and strengthen your relationship with them. You can grow your email list by giving useful rewards on your site. This could be free downloads, exclusive content, or discounts in return for visitors’ email addresses.

Use the marketing tools that come with your website builder, or connect with email marketing platforms to create good and focused email campaigns. You should also separate your email list based on things like age, interests, or actions. This will help you send more personal emails and get better responses.

Send out regular newsletters, special offers, or updates about your website. This helps keep your audience informed and interested in your brand. Make it easy for visitors to subscribe to your email list. Clearly show signup forms on your site and offer great rewards.

How much does it typically cost to design a business website?

The cost can change based on what you need. Simple website builders often have free plans. Premium plans, which include more features and custom domain name registration, usually cost between $5 and $50 each month. Many of these services provide free trials, and you don’t need a credit card for that.
